.toc-list{list-style:none}.toc-item,.toc-list{margin:0;padding:0}.toc-link{display:block;--tw-text-opacity:1;color:rgb(64 84 174/var(--tw-text-opacity,1));text-decoration:none;transition:all .2s ease;padding:.5rem .5rem .5rem .75rem;font-size:.95rem;line-height:1.4}.toc-link:active,.toc-link:hover{--tw-text-opacity:1;color:rgb(78 194 137/var(--tw-text-opacity,1))}.toc-level-2 .toc-link{font-weight:600;padding-left:.75rem}.toc-level-3 .toc-link{font-weight:400;padding-left:2rem;font-size:.9rem;--tw-text-opacity:1;color:rgb(64 84 174/var(--tw-text-opacity,1))}.toc-level-3 .toc-link:hover,.toc-link.active{--tw-text-opacity:1;color:rgb(78 194 137/var(--tw-text-opacity,1))}.toc-link.active{font-weight:600}#sidebar-toc::-webkit-scrollbar{width:6px}#sidebar-toc::-webkit-scrollbar-track{background:#f1f1f1;border-radius:3px}#sidebar-toc::-webkit-scrollbar-thumb{background:#888;border-radius:3px}#sidebar-toc::-webkit-scrollbar-thumb:hover{background:#555}@media(max-width:768px){#sidebar-toc{position:relative;top:0;margin-bottom:2rem}}